Eight Palestinians were killed on Sunday in an Israeli airstrike on a training college near Gaza City being used to distribute aid, Palestinian witnesses said, as Israeli tanks pushed further into the southern city of Rafah.

The strike hit part of a vocational college the U.N. Palestinian refugee agency the United Nations Relief and Works Agency (UNRWA) runs that is now providing aid to displaced families, the witnesses said.

"Some people were coming to receive coupons, and others had been displaced from their houses, and they were sheltering here," said Mohammed Tafesh, one of the witnesses.
